Celtics 88, Pistons 79: Instant Analysis

Why the Celtics won: The supporting cast. As good as Paul Pierce and Kevin Garnett played, the difference was that guys like Leon Powe, Kendrick Perkins, Rajon Rondo and the rest stepped up and hit shots when the two stars gave the ball up. When the C’s have a handful of guys making shots, they’re even tougher to guard.

Why the Pistons lost: The stars. Chauncey Billups and Rasheed Wallace struggled, shooting a combined 6-for-18 from the field. Chauncey’s clearly not playing at 100 percent and ‘Sheed was getting all he could handle from KG.

Key numbers: Kevin Garnett (26 pts, 9 rebs); Paul Pierce (22 pts); Antonio McDyess (14 pts, 11 rebs); Assists (BOS 27, DET 15);
